Co-pyrolysis Characteristics and Synergistic Interaction of Waste Polyethylene Terephthalate and Woody Biomass towards Bio-Oil Production
Table 2
Physical properties of the oils.
| Properties | Ficus benghalensis | Ficus benghalensis-to-PET ratio | PET | Unit | 80 : 20 | 60 : 40 | 40 : 60 | 20 : 80 |
| Density | 1010 | 995 | 965 | 930 | 915 | 910 | (kg/m3) | Viscosity | 7.1 | 6.9 | 6.4 | 5.8 | 5.0 | 4.1 | (cSt) | Flash point | 135 | 130 | 110 | 92 | 73 | 58 | (°C) | Carbon | 43.52 | 46.33 | 50.14 | 54.89 | 59.20 | 63.50 | (wt (%)) | Hydrogen | 7.10 | 7.10 | 7.31 | 7.72 | 7.90 | 8.10 | (wt (%)) | Nitrogen | 0.74 | 0.72 | 0.70 | 0.66 | 0.59 | 0.54 | (wt (%)) | Sulfur | 0.21 | 0.19 | 0.15 | 0.11 | 0.07 | 0.04 | (wt (%)) | Oxygena | 48.45 | 46.12 | 41.02 | 35.30 | 32.41 | 27.82 | (wt (%)) | H/C molar ratio | 1.943 | 1.826 | 1.734 | 1.671 | 1.590 | 1.519 | — | O/C molar ratio | 0.835 | 0.739 | 0.624 | 0.501 | 0.408 | 0.328 | — | Heating value | 17.91 | 18.92 | 21.36 | 23.90 | 26.83 | 28.64 | (MJ/kg) |
|
|
aBy difference.
